Repair Timeline Set for 'Ciudad de S贸ller' Following Engine Fire Incident
The ferry 'Ciudad de S贸ller' is expected to be unavailable for service for a duration of seven to ten days as a result of a fire that occurred in one of its auxiliary engines at the port of Valencia. Trasmed CEO Ettore Morace confirmed the timeline for the vessel's repairs. During this interim period, the Valencia-Palma ferry route will be serviced by the 'Ciudad de Palma.' Additionally, in a collaborative effort, passengers and freight traveling on the Barcelona-Palma route will be accommodated by Balearia, reflecting a partnership between the two maritime companies. Currently, the 'Ciudad de S贸ller' is docked at the passenger terminal in Valencia, awaiting repairs.
Swift Action Contained Fire on 'Ciudad de S贸ller' During Valencia Voyage
On August 18, 2025, the passenger ferry 'Ciudad de S贸ller,' while traveling between Palma and Val猫ncia, experienced a fire in its auxiliary engine located within the engine room. Fortunately, no crew members were present in the engine area at the time of the incident. Prompt action was taken when eight firefighters boarded the vessel at Terminal Transmediterr谩nea to combat the blaze. The Emergency Coordination Center of the Valencian Government quickly activated the Port's Special Emergency Plan (PEE) to handle the situation effectively. Thanks to their swift response, the fire was extinguished, and damage was confined mainly to the affected engine area. However, the 'Ciudad de S贸ller' has been temporarily immobilized at the port of Val猫ncia, pending inspections to assess the damage and determine when it can return to service. Remarkably, no injuries were reported among passengers or crew. In light of the incident, passengers and cargo from the Palma-bound ferry were promptly transferred to alternative ships operating the Val猫ncia-Palma route. Additionally, the ferry 'Ciudad de Barcelona,' which previously serviced the Valencia-Ibiza-Palma route, undertook the reverse journey from Palma to Ibiza, and then to Val猫ncia to alleviate any inconvenience caused by the 'Ciudad de S贸ller' situation. Emergency Helicopter Evacuation of 88-Year-Old Passenger from Ciudad de S贸ller
On August 14, 2025, an urgent medical evacuation unfolded when an 88-year-old passenger aboard the Ciudad de S贸ller required immediate attention. The vessel was navigating approximately 59 nautical miles off the Spanish coast, en route from Palma to Valencia. In response to the distress signal, the CCS Valencia of Salvamento Mar铆timo promptly dispatched the SAR helicopter Helimer 223. The skilled crew successfully hoisted the elderly patient aboard and swiftly transported him to La Fe Hospital for further medical care.
